Change in visual acuity in laser photocoagulation group,Change in visual acuity in bromfenac group,Change in visual acuity in observation group
Prospective or cohort study to compare the effects of grid macular laser, topical bromfenac
 0.09% and placebo (carboxymethyl cellulose 0.5%) medication in diabetic macular edema.
 
 60 eyes with macular edema of two types i.e. cystoid macular edema (CME) and clinically
 significant macular edema (CSME) were divided into three groups with 20 patients in each
 group. One group was treated with grid laser photocoagulation, the second group was treated
 with topical bromfenac 0.09% drops two times a day and the third group was treated with
 topical carboxy methyl cellulose 0.5% three times a day (placebo treatment).
